Output 81d8a832eaafea5923a60f0ff2acc44cc347189e7a265bca741aad690417e126:1

value
90275730020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cd261a020422f1b9d8ea1776c43c7b363274f3c OP_EQUALVERIFY OP_CHECKSIG
address
1DqbdQhqQMWkb8JjADKmMc5aQQw8mUXzd8
transaction
81d8a832eaafea5923a60f0ff2acc44cc347189e7a265bca741aad690417e126
confirmations
470211
spent
true